### Action Item: Spoolhaven Retry Storm

From last Tuesday's outage: the Spoolhaven print service retried failed jobs without backoff, saturating the render pool. Fix merged; retries now use capped exponential backoff with jitter. Owner will monitor for a week before closing. The agreed retry constants are recorded below.

constants for yadup-kajof:
RATE_LIMITS = {
    "zorwyn": 1,
    "druwyn": 1,
}

☐ **Hardware lab access — first day**

Walk the new starter over to the hardware lab on Level B1 (past the kitchenette, blue door). Make sure they've done the ESD briefing first — no exceptions, Farrow will send it back otherwise. Show them the sign-in tablet, the tool checkout shelf, and where the safety specs live. Their permanent badge takes a day or two to sync, so in the meantime the lab keypad accepts the starter code below.

door code, yagap-bahof: bdg-O-05

## Local Setup

Archiver moves cold storage buckets from the Tarnbrook tier to deep archive. Clone the repo, install deps with the bootstrap script, and copy the sample config into your home directory. Run the dry-run mode first; it lists candidate buckets without touching them. The tool tracks archive manifests in a small metadata database, required even for dry runs. Before your first run, set the metadata database connection string shown below.

primary connection of tajeg-tajop = postgresql://julax_svc:DI@db-e7f3.kelvidyn.corp:5432/rusdor